Shin-Umeda Shokudogai Street: A Culinary Journey in Osaka
Experience the vibrant flavors of Shin-Umeda Shokudogai Street in Osaka, a culinary hub where Japanese cuisine and international flavors unite.
Shin-Umeda Shokudogai Street is a food lover's paradise nestled in the heart of Osaka. This bustling destination is renowned for its diverse array of eateries, each offering a unique taste of Japan's rich culinary heritage. Visitors will be greeted by the tantalizing aromas wafting from the myriad food stalls and restaurants lining the street, making it an irresistible spot for any tourist. Whether you’re in the mood for steaming bowls of ramen, delicate sushi, or savory okonomiyaki, Shin-Umeda Shokudogai Street has something to satisfy every palate. In addition to traditional Japanese dishes, the area also features a variety of international cuisine, reflecting Osaka's cosmopolitan vibe. The lively atmosphere is perfect for leisurely strolls or quick bites, allowing you to sample different flavors as you explore. Each restaurant boasts its own charm, with many offering outdoor seating that invites you to soak up the local ambiance. As you wander through this vibrant food court, don't miss the chance to interact with friendly locals and fellow travelers, sharing recommendations and experiences. Shin-Umeda Shokudogai Street is not just a place to eat; it’s a cultural experience that immerses you in the culinary landscape of Osaka. Ideal for families, couples, and solo travelers alike, this street is a testament to the city's love for food and community. Be sure to visit during lunch or dinner hours to fully appreciate the hustle and bustle of this dining hotspot, and consider trying a few different dishes to make the most of your visit. This hidden gem in the city is waiting to be discovered, promising a memorable gastronomic adventure.
Local tips
- Visit during weekday lunch hours for a less crowded experience.
- Try a variety of dishes by ordering small portions to share.
- Look out for local recommendations and popular dishes on display.
- Don’t miss the seasonal specialties that vary throughout the year.
- Bring cash, as some smaller vendors may not accept credit cards.

Getting There
-
Walking
If you are in Umeda Station (which is a key transportation hub), exit through the East Exit. Once outside, you will see a large open area. Head towards the Grand Front Osaka building, which is a prominent landmark. Walk along the main road (Midosuji Street) for about 8 minutes, keeping the Grand Front Osaka building on your left. You will eventually arrive at a pedestrian bridge. Cross this bridge, and upon descending, you will find yourself at the entrance of Shin-Umeda Shokudogai Street, located at 9-26 Kakudacho, Kita Ward.
-
Subway
If you're closer to Nakatsu Station, take the Osaka Metro (Midosuji Line) towards Senri-Chuo and alight at Umeda Station. This journey takes approximately 4 minutes and costs around 230 yen. After exiting the station, follow the walking directions provided above to reach Shin-Umeda Shokudogai Street.
-
Bus
From the Umeda Sky Building, you can catch a bus from the nearby Umeda Sky Building Bus Stop. Look for buses headed towards Osaka Station. The bus ride will take about 5 minutes and may cost around 210 yen. Disembark at the Osaka Station, then follow the walking directions towards Shin-Umeda Shokudogai Street as described above.
